What is Dermovate?

Dermovate cream and ointment are the most recommended treatment that treats resistant skin inflammation. In two weeks you can notice improvement in your area of treatment.

You need to consult your healthcare provider before, during, and after applying Dermovate medicine for effective results.

Overdose, underdose, side effects, and application methods are among the few things that should be clinically managed by a pharmacist or by following instructions laid down in the patients' leaflet.

What is Dermovate used for?

Dermovate is an effective medication for severe skin issues like eczema, dermatitis, psoriasis, and lupus, typically prescribed when gentler treatments fail. It's advised to use it with moisturizer for skin health. However, it's not a permanent cure; it helps manage symptoms like flare-ups and itching.

Dermovate is used for:

  • Atopic eczema
  • Psoriasis
  • Seborrheic dermatitis
  • Allergic/Irritant contact dermatitis
  • Discoid lupus erythematosus
  • An eruption of hard nodules on the skin with intense itching
  • Erythroderma is characterized by intense and widespread reddening of the skin

How to apply Dermovate Cream & Ointment

Always follow your doctor's instructions when following Dermovate cream or ointment. You can also follow the instructions under the patient's leaflet that is packaged together with the medication. Below are a few steps to follow when applying the medicine.

  • Clean your hands before applying the cream/ointment to the treatment area
  • Evenly apply a thin layer of dermovate to the affected areas
  • Use a loose dressing to cover the area being treated
  • Clean your hands after applying the medicine.

How much Dermovate should you use per week?

The total amount of Dermovate you should apply should not exceed 50g (50ml) per week.

When should you stop using Dermovate medication?

You should stop using Dermovate if you experience serious allergic reactions, decreased adrenal functions, and high levels of corticosteroids in your bloodstream.

❌ Dermovate should not be used to treat:

Dermovate is only formulated to treat skin inflammation, avoid using Dermovate to treat the following skin conditions:

  • Rosacea
  • Bacterial skin infections such as impetigo
  • Itchy genitals and anus 
  • Acne vulgaris
  • Perioral Dermatitis
  • Fungal skin infections such as thrush, ringworm, and athlete's foot
  • Nappy Rash
  • Dermatitis around the mouth
  • Viral skin infections such as chickenpox, shingles, cold sores, or herpes simplex

How does Dermovate cream work?

Dermovate contains Clobetasol Propionate, a corticosteroid that reduces inflammation by decreasing the release of inflammatory chemicals in skin cells. This helps alleviate swelling, itching, and redness associated with skin conditions like eczema and psoriasis.

Dermovate cream isn't suitable for broken skin, open wounds, or areas affected by certain conditions like viral, bacterial, or fungal skin infections, acne, or itching without inflammation.

Are there alternative treatments to Dermovate?

Other steroid treatments can be used in place of Dermovate, they include Eumovate and Betnovate. Aveeno and E45 cream are some of the non-steroid creams used in place of Dermovate, however, it is advisable to consult your doctor to get the best treatment option based on your symptoms.

Directions

Dos and don'ts

✅ Apply a moisturizer (not necessary) only when Dermovate has been fully absorbed.
✅ Use Dermovate on your skin only
✅ Consult your doctor if your symptoms do not improve after 2 weeks 
✅ Use a smaller potion of Dermovate when applying to a child's area of treatment

❌ DON'Ts

  • Do not use Dermovate around naked flames. Dermovate is a fire hazard getting in contact with naked flames can burn your dressing which has already been in contact with the medicine.
  • Do not use airtight dressing to cover the area of treatment. Tight dressings increase the rate at which the medicine is absorbed in your body increasing the risk of side effects.
  • Do not use cream/ointments on your eyes, nose, or mouth.
  • Do not use the ointment /cream past the doctor-recommended timeline

Stop using the treatment if the area of treatment becomes infected

  • Avoid using Dermovate as a moisturizer, use it only as instructed by your pharmacist.
  • Do not apply thick layers of Dermovate on the area of treatment
  • Dermovate contains 50mg of propylene glycol per gram which may cause skin irritation. Consult your doctor in case of severe skin irritation.

Dosage

Fingertip units pictogram for adults.

Skin area of treatment Fingertip units used 
One leg6 finger units
One arm3 finger units 
One foot2 finger units 
Face 2 ½ finger units 
Back of the neck7 finger units 
Front of the neck7 finger units 

Fingertip units pictogram for children.

for age 1-2 years:

Skin area of treatment Fingertip units used 
Arm and hand skin area1 ½ units
Leg and foot skin area 2units
Face and neck skin area1 ½ units

Front Skin area

2 units
Back including buttocks3 units

Fingertip units pictogram for children.

for age 3-5 years:

Skin area of treatment Fingertip units used
Arm and hand skin area2 units
Leg and foot skin area3 units
Face and neck skin area1 ½ units
Front Skin area3 units
Back including buttocks 3 ½ units

Fingertip units pictogram for children.

for age 6-10 years:

Skin area of treatment Fingertip units used
Arm and hand skin area2 ½ units
Leg and foot skin area4 ½ units
Face and neck skin area2 units 
Front Skin area3 ½ units
Back including buttocks5 units

Warnings

⚠️ Precautions and warnings.

Before using Dermovate medication always seek medical advice from a doctor or a qualified pharmacist. Below are some of the precautions and warnings for using Dermovate medicine.

  • If you are allergic to corticosteroids or other allergy types, consult your doctor before taking dermovate cream medication.
  • Share with your doctor, your medical history before using the medication
  • Avoid using Dermovate if you have an infection or soar in your area of treatment

⚠️ Consult your doctor before using Dermovate if you have a serious injury or going through surgery treatment.

  • Avoid using Dermovate cream during pregnancy especially if the risks outweigh the benefits
  • Avoid using Dermovate as a breastfeeding mother as the cream may pass to the breast milk
  • Talk to your healthcare provider before using Dermovate cream alongside other medications
  • Do not use Dermovate if you experience bone pains or severe bone symptoms
  • Always clean your skin before applying Dermovate to prevent infections

⚠️ If you have psoriasis, consult a doctor before using the cream. The doctor may advise you to use airtight dressing especially if you have thick patches of psoriasis on your knees or elbows.

  • Using the cream around a chronic leg ulcer increases the risk of infections or allergic reactions.
  • Avoid using the cream around your eyes as it may cause glaucoma or cataracts
  • Use Dovobet for no more than 5 days to avoid facial skin thinning (excessive use may damage your facial skin)
  • Avoid using the medicine on children under the age of 1
  • Do not use bandages in areas where you apply the cream
  • Avoid smoking while using Dermovate cream/ointment.

FAQ

  • Can you use Dermovate with other medicines?

    If you are using ritonavir, aldesleukin, itraconazole, or any other medication that contains corticosteroids. Always consult your doctor to get further guidance.

  • Can a pregnant or breastfeeding mother use Dermovate?

    Avoid using Dermovate on your breast area as a breastfeeding mother to prevent the baby from suckling in the medicine. Pregnant women should always consult the doctor before using Dermovate.

  • Does Dermovate affect your fertility?

    There are no proven effects of Dermovate on fertility, always talk to your doctor if you are planning to get pregnant,

  • What is the difference between dermovate ointment and cream?

    Dermonate cream is preferred on moist skin while Dermovate ointment works best on dry skin.

  • Which is better Dermovate ointment or cream?

    The two medicines serve the same purpose, though their ability to work depends on the texture of the area of treatment.

  • Is Dermovate an antifungal?

    Dermovate belongs to a group of steroid medicines and is only used to treat skin inflammation.

  • What forms does Dermovate come in?

    Dermovate comes in 3 forms: Ointment, cream, and scalp application.Each gram Dermovate contains 0.05% of clobetasol 17 propionate.

Side Effects

Dermovate Cream Common side effects:

Common side effects are mostly manageable and can disappear over time, they may affect 1 out of 10 people. Examples of common side effects include:

  • Pain 
  • Burning sensation 
  • Irritation
  • Headache 
  • Change of skin color 
  • Skin rash
  • Skin thinning
  • Tearing of the skin

Uncommon side effects 

Uncommon side effects if not well managed may lead to serious problems, they may affect 1 out of 100 people. Examples of uncommon side effects include:

  • Blood vessels become visible on the skin
  • Skin thinning that leads to stretch marks 
  • Hair loss on the scalp 
  • Acne
  • Numbness on the fingers
  • Unhealing skin condition

Infrequent side effects 

1 out of 10,000 people experience rare side effects due to long-term use of Dermovate. Examples of rare side effects include:

  • Serious allergic reactions such as swelling, itching, and difficulty in breathing
  • Fatigue increased thirst urge to urinate, and weak muscles are symptoms caused by the increase in corticosteroid levels in the bloodstream.
  • Hives 
  • Pustular psoriasis. They are pus-filled, raised bumps that appear after treatment.
  • Allergic reactions in the area of treatment
  • Obesity 
  • Wrinkles on the skin
  • Dry skin
  • Hair loss.
